State health officials warn about infected raw milk

It’s illegal to sell raw milk for human consumption in Florida. Yet, there have been 21 recent human cases of disease-causing bacteria linked to consumption of raw milk from the same farm, state health officials said Monday.

Six of the victims were children under the age of 10.

Seven of the cases resulted in hospitalization with two people suffering severe complications, prompting the Florida Department of Health to send a health warning about the consumption of raw milk.
